Ingredients of Fluffy Pancake Recipe



  • 2 cups all-purpose | plain flour

  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ar or sweetener

  • 4 teaspoons baking powder

  • 1/4 teaspoon baking soda

  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

  • 1 1/2 cups milk (plus up to 1/4 cup extra if needed)

  • 1/4 cup butter, melted

  • 2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ract

  • 1 large egg


INSTRUCTIONS

  1. Combine together the flour, sugar (or sweetener), baking powder, baking soda and salt in a large-sized bowl. Make a well in the center and add the milk, slightly cooled melted butter, vanilla, and egg.

  2. Use a wire whisk to whisk the wet ingredients together first before slowly folding them into the dry ingredients. Mix together until smooth (there maybe a couple of lumps but that's okay).
    (The batter will be thick and creamy inconsistency. If you find the batter too thick -- doesn't pour off the ladle or out of the measuring cup smoothly -- fold a couple of tablespoons of extra milk into the batter at a time until reaching desired consistency).

  3. Set the batter aside and allow to rest while heating up your pan or griddle.

  4. Heat a nonstick pan or griddle over low-medium heat and wipe over with a little butter to lightly grease pan. Pour ¼ cup of batter onto the pan and spread out gently into a round shape with the back of your ladle or measuring cup.

  5. When the underside is golden and bubbles begin to appear on the surface, flip with a spatula and cook until golden. Repeat with the remaining batter.

  6. Serve with honey, maple syrup, fruit, ice cream or frozen yogurt, or enjoy plain!
